Stepping into the Ring . . . Getting a Love Tap

Image
            Have you ever had those times of prayer and contemplation when you feel like you stepped into a boxing ring with God? And, much like any of our chances against a real heavy weight champion, we get, not only knocked down, but knocked out. Kierkegaard wrote about the Bible that it is not only speaking to me, it is speaking about me. This does not only happen reading the Bible. There are other books that bring the same response. They seem to just pummel us where God is concerned. It can be so convicting that our selfish, complacent faith is bruised and beaten. It is not that God wants to beat us into submission. That’s not his style or modus operandi. He loves us too much for that. But, there are times when what we encounter brings us to the point of feeling that we have been dropped into the ring with God.             This happened to me today in such a powerful way. Ninja's For Christ

           I was just on vacation visiting my son. He is a martial artist and he invited his mother and me to watch him test for his 4 th degree black belt in taekwondo. While we were there, we observed him as he trained in jujitsu. That’s what he does for fun. He teaches taekwondo and for recreation does jujitsu. I took taekwondo for several years so I know a little about it. We were taught to try to avoid being knocked to the ground. On the ground, you were in trouble. Jujitsu is a ground based martial art. So, I guess my son has both situations covered.             Taekwondo is graceful, fluid and well-choreographed. Each move is part of a patterned whole which is called a “form.” Each move is the result of a particular technique and designed with a purpose. All those moves are for more than just looking pretty.
